4.0 out of 5 stars Almost Perfect.......but missed the mark, July 12 2001
This review is from: Vintage & Vogue Ladies Compacts: Identification & Value Guide (Hardcover)
From the opening page to almost the middle of the book is absolutely wonderful! The photographs are exquisitely done in color, the descriptions are complete & there are usually no more than 4-6 photos per page. Suddenly, it stops and the reader is left with pages filled with very small, black & white photos and wondering "What the heck happened??" The smaller compacts should have been the ones in the larger pictures and they are screaming for color! As for the educational & reference content, this book is hard to beat and will make an excellent tool for reading about the mechanisms of vintage compacts. Plus, the variety of compacts is mind-boggling! Recommended purchase but don't expect 100% satisfaction with the photographs & layouts.

4.0 out of 5 stars a complement to the Mueller books, Jun 20 2001

This review is from: Vintage & Vogue Ladies Compacts: Identification & Value Guide (Hardcover)
Gerson knows her compacts--she is an absolute authority, and this book gives many fine examples of compacts from all periods of time as well as good information about collecting. The color photos are a joy to look at. However, I don't like the way the book is organized--it's difficult to find what your looking for because things aren't arranged in logical order. In addition, I think it's a shame to have black and white photos--the majority of compacts really can't be appreciated unless they are seen in color, hence my 4-star rating. Mueller's two books are arranged better, with color photos for every compact, and Gerson should have tried to emulate that while making the book her own. But this book complements Mueller's, and for a rabid compact collector, this book is a welcome addition to the other books out there.

5.0 out of 5 stars Outstanding New Guide To Delight Ladies' Compact Collectors, Mar 5 2001

This review is from: Vintage & Vogue Ladies Compacts: Identification & Value Guide (Hardcover)
Brand new, year 2001, outstanding 2nd edition of this guide to ladies' compacts. The beautiful 368 page hardbound volume with laminated covers features more than 2,000 large, full color photos of the highest quality. Major topics include History of Compacts, Guide for the Collector, Inventions, Designs, Tips for cCllectors, and much more. Each of the super photos includes plenty of descriptive text, along with values. Some trade materials are also provided. A must-have volume for fans of this popular collectible.
